About the Role As Manager, Customs Compliance, you will protect Kohl's interests by ensuring compliance with all regulations imposed by U.S. Customs and other government agencies. What You'll Do Implement and direct classification processes for all direct import merchandise Manage annual duty payments to ensure the accuracy of payment and supporting documentation Interact with government agencies, agents and vendors to resolve issues Serve as a US Customs point of contact and ensure compliance Ensure the integrity and clarity of information used for business planning and decision-making and advise business partners with well-researched recommendations and solutions Serve as a point of contact for Product Development and Merchant partners for item classification inquiries Develop or re-design processes to systematically minimize error, increase productivity, and reduce expense Assure quality and precision in research and analysis Manage team in identifying opportunities for duty engineering Encourage and recognize Associates' commitment to self-development, maintain an open and trusting team environment and communicate clear and consistent goals for the team Quarterly travel to Customs brokerage offices and/or training conferences, as necessary Additional tasks may be assigned What Skills You Have Required 5+ years in Import Compliance or Global Trade operations. Bachelor's degree or equivalent professional experience. Comprehensive understanding of internal controls, U.S. Customs regulations, and partner government agency requirements. Active U.S. Customs Broker License required. Proficiency with Microsoft Office, Google Workspace, and data/reporting tools Supervisory and people management experience. Strong analytical, organizational, problem-solving, and verbal and written communication skills Meticulous attention to detail and data accuracy Ability to lead and manage complex, multi-layered work processes from initiation to completion Thorough knowledge of merchandise classification guidelines utilizing the Harmonized Tariff Schedule (HTS). Strong familiarity with Customs Broker responsibilities and entry processes. Preferred Certified Customs Specialist (CCS) designation preferred. Experience in retail or high-volume import environments Familiarity with tools such as Qlik, BigQuery, and ACE
